利用智能手机磁力计测量液体黏滞系数
Measurement of Liquid Viscosity Coefficient by Smartphone Magnetometer
【摘要】 利用智能手机搭建了一套可视化的简谐振动系统,通过小球在液体中欠阻尼振动的振幅衰减,测量液体的黏滞系数。实验使用手机Phyphox软件中的磁力计传感器,将小球欠阻尼振动振幅的测量转化为磁感应强度大小的测量,并通过Origin软件对采集的数据进行非线性拟合,得到液体阻尼因数,求出液体的黏滞系数。
【Abstract】 This experiment builds a set of visualized simple harmonic vibration system with smartphones.In this experiment,the liquid viscosity coefficient is calculated by observing the ball’s amplitude attenuation in the process of damped oscillation in liquids.Using the magnetometer sensor in the Phyphox,the measurement of the damped amplitude of the ball is transformed into the magnetic induction,and data can be processed by nonlinear fitting through the Origin.According to the fitting result,the liquid damping constant can be determined,and the viscous coefficient of the liquid can be calculated.
